Blade quality and cutting performance
The quality of the blade plays a major role in how effectively a tree pole pruner can cut through branches. Blades made from hardened steel tend to stay sharper longer and provide a clean cut that minimizes damage to the tree.
Sharpness directly affects how easily branches are trimmed without excessive force, making the task less tiring. When selecting a tree pole pruner, it helps to know the maximum branch diameter it can handle comfortably since thicker branches might require more robust cutting power. Some models allow easy blade replacement, which is useful when the cutting edge dulls over time.
This also simplifies maintenance, keeping the tool in good working order and extending its lifespan.

Pole material and length
When choosing the best tree pole pruner, understanding the pole material and length plays a key role in finding a tool that balances ease of use with durability. Poles made from lightweight materials like aluminum offer advantage in maneuverability and reduce fatigue during extended pruning sessions, making them ideal for casual or infrequent use. On the other hand, tools constructed from more heavy-duty materials such as fiberglass or carbon fiber provide enhanced strength and resistance to bending, which suits tougher jobs or more professional use.

Types of tree pole pruners
When selecting a pruner designed to reach high branches, it helps to understand the differences among manual and powered options. Manual pruners operate through direct physical effort, making them lightweight and generally easier to maintain, while powered versions often use batteries or electricity to provide greater cutting power with less exertion.
The cutting mechanism also varies, with some tools using a rope that pulls the blade closed when you tug, and others utilizing a lever system that tends to deliver more precise and powerful cuts. Consider what tasks are most common, such as occasional light trimming or frequent pruning of thicker branches, and how comfortable you are managing the tool’s weight and reach.
Paying attention to these features will help in choosing a pruner that matches both your project needs and physical comfort.

How Do Telescoping Pole Pruners Compare To Fixed-Length Models?
Telescoping pole pruners offer the advantage of adjustable length, allowing users to reach high branches without the need for ladders. This versatility makes them ideal for varying tree heights and tight spaces. They are often more compact when collapsed, making storage and transport easier. In contrast, fixed-length models provide consistent stability and strength due to their solid, one-piece construction. They tend to be lighter and simpler to use but lack flexibility in reach. Choosing between the two depends on the specific pruning tasks and storage preferences.
